Description

I shot this in my front yard last week. Since the sun was behind me, I couldn't figure out where the rays were coming from, so I emailed Ken Smith, who sent it to a weather guy. Turns out they are anti-crepuscular rays..caused by the same water droplets that cause the rainbow to appear. I was glad to hear the explanation. Thanks, Ken!
